PATHANAMTHITTA: The Sabarimala temple is scheduled to open on Monday, April 13 for Vishu festival.

AK Sudheer Nampoothiri will open the sreekovil, marking the commencement of the Vishu celebrations, in the presence of Thantri Mahesh Mohanaru. However, there will be no entry for devotees as part of the lockdown restrictions.

The sreekovil will be opened for Vishukani darsan at 5 am on April 14. Rituals and poojas will be performed. The temple will be closed on April 18 at 7.30 pm.

Devotees can offer poojas online through the portal www.onlinetdb.com. Offerings can also be made through Dhanalaxmi Bank accounts 012600100000019, 012601200000086.
